Two pages, each approximately 34.5 cm square. Wooden square tray/serving tray, lacquerware This is the larger set. (There is also a smaller one, 32 cm square) These are old items. I believe they are from the early Showa era, but I'm not sure. They were used in the home for weddings, funerals, and other ceremonies. They can be used as trays or as individual place settings for meals. I believe they are lacquered. They are hand-carved, so the patterns are all different. There are various imperfections, such as damage, stains, chips, scratches, and peeling, as well as the mold-like appearance typical of lacquerware. The weights also vary. Please note that some areas may not be visible in the photos. There is a name written on the back. It's not written in magic marker, but in white paint.
